How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al Actually Works

Avoid the risk of long-term damage by hiring a professional for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al.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your home is restored to its original condition. A proper process matters, corners cut can lead to costly repairs and potential health hazards.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our crew evaluates the affected area, identifying the source of the water and determining the best course of action. We use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and assess the extent of the damage. This step typically takes 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the size of the area.

Step 2: Water Removal

We use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ract the standing water. Our team works efficiently to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age. This step usually takes 1-2 hours, depending on the amount of water present.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team uses specialized equipment to dry the affected area, including dehumidifiers and air movers. We work to reduce the moisture levels in the air, preventing mold and further water damage. This step typically takes 2-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our crew thoroughly cleans and sanitizes the affected area, ensuring it's safe for you to return to your home. We use eco-friendly cleaning products and follow strict protocols to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Our team works with you to restore your home to its original condition. We repair or replace damaged materials, ensuring your home is safe and secure. This step typ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the extent of the damage.

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No You can handle small spills with basic cleaning products and a wet vacuum.
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es Larger spills need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Hidden water damage No Yes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and address the issue.
Water damage in sensitive areas (e.g., electrical, plumbing) No Yes Water damage in sensitive areas needs specialized expertise to prevent further damage and ensure safety.
Water damage with mold or mildew growth No Yes Mold and mildew growth need specialized equipment and expertise to address the issue and prevent further damage.

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al Cost In Glenpool, OK

The cost of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Glenpool, OK. These estimates are based on real-world cost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al (less than 100 sq. Ft.) $500 - $1,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water present.
Water Removal (over 100 sq. Ft.) $1,500 - $5,000 The size of the affected area, the amount of water present, and the need for specialized equipment.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 - $3,000 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 - $1,500 The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ning products used.
Restoration and Reconstruction $3,000 - $10,000 The ext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the need for specialized labor and materials.
